Ground work begins on Khams Shamat tourism project in Syria
Dubai-based MAF Properties has commenced the ground works for its first tourism project in Syria, called Khams Shamat. Located in the Yafour area on the Damascus-Beirut highway, the project will occupy a total land space of 1 million square metres and is planned to contain hotels, a town square with outdoor shopping and restaurants, commercial office space and touristic accommodations. The company will soon announce the names of the leading companies to operate the major hotels in Khams Shamat. The first phase of the project will be completed in 2014.
